Output 534496140abb5bf42f361fd2bc68e75d9248e53d9a68fa4f0b284f2a4437593a:3

value
49289473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39f7fc81802bc36fcdd13f4a93a0178842b90d1f OP_EQUAL
address
MDBfpkw3JpGkePUQZKg5qxxtsn2r5Cbs3Z
transaction
534496140abb5bf42f361fd2bc68e75d9248e53d9a68fa4f0b284f2a4437593a
spent
true